Job Description

We are looking for a Lead IT Security Endpoint Engineer to help strengthen and support enterprise endpoint protection capabilities in Coppell, Texas. This Long-term Contract position is well suited for a security specialist with strong attention to detail who brings deep endpoint expertise and enjoys improving the resilience of workstations, servers, and other digital assets across a hybrid environment. The role combines hands-on engineering, operational support, and cross-functional collaboration to enhance security controls and drive continuous improvement.

Job Responsibility

  • Design, implement, and sustain endpoint security technologies that protect enterprise devices and support overall cybersecurity objectives
  • Administer and optimize tools such as CrowdStrike, secure web gateway solutions, and related scanning platforms to improve endpoint visibility and defense
  • Investigate product issues, perform troubleshooting, and escalate complex technical concerns when advanced support is required
  • Partner with security teams, infrastructure groups, and business stakeholders to deliver endpoint protection enhancements that align with company standards
  • Contribute to the execution of the endpoint security strategy by identifying practical improvements in tooling, coverage, and operational processes
  • Assess emerging security technologies and help shape recommendations for architecture, deployment approach, and long-term adoption
  • Maintain strong malware detection coverage across supported devices by validating agent health, policy effectiveness, and response readiness
  • Identify opportunities to streamline repetitive security tasks and assist with automation efforts that improve endpoint operations and efficiency
  • Create and update technical documentation, operating procedures, and shared knowledge resources to support team effectiveness
  • Support a hybrid work schedule with 3 days onsite and 2 days remote, including onsite presence on Tuesdays, Wednesdays, and one additional team-designated day

Requirements

  • 5-7 years of cybersecurity experience, including significant focus on endpoint security engineering or administration
  • Hands-on experience working with the CrowdStrike platform and related endpoint protection capabilities
  • Knowledge of security controls for SaaS environments, Azure AD, and Microsoft Azure infrastructure
  • Strong understanding of Windows, Linux, and macOS, along with enterprise systems such as servers, networks, applications, databases, and cloud platforms
  • Experience with endpoint firewall technologies and foundational network security concepts
  • Demonstrated analytical thinking and problem-solving ability with strong attention to detail
  • Effective ver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to work productively with both technical and non-technical teams
  • Familiarity with broader information security concepts such as data privacy, database security, and cyber governance
